William P. Buelter obituary, death, a 79-year-old resident of Plymouth, has tragically passed away following a car crash involving a semi-truck. The incident occurred on Tuesday, August 13, 2024, at the intersection of County Roads A and U, between Cascade and Greenbush.

According to preliminary findings from the Sheboygan County Sheriff’s Office, Mr. Buelter was involved in a collision when he reportedly stopped at County Road P before pulling out in front of the semi-truck traveling on County Road A.

The semi-truck, which was transporting 5,500 gallons of liquid manure, was unable to avoid the collision. Emergency responders pronounced Mr. Buelter dead at the scene.

The driver of the semi-truck, who sustained serious injuries, was airlifted to a Milwaukee hospital via Flight for Life. The severity of his injuries underscores the gravity of the crash and the impact it has had on all involved.

The Sheboygan County Sheriff’s Office is continuing its investigation into the circumstances surrounding the crash. The intersection where the collision occurred has been a point of concern for local authorities, and the investigation aims to determine all contributing factors.
